Alice Cooper has placed Hollywood star Johnny Depp in the same exalted company as celebrated rock guitarists Slash and Brian May after he was recently joined on stage by Depp during a gig at London’s 100 Club.
Speaking to Bang! Showbiz, Cooper declared his intention to work with Depp again, and lauded his guitar-playing talents which he claims is comparable to the Guns n Roses and Queen legends.
“I’d work with him again,” he said. “I mean the guy is a valid guitar player, we told him anytime he wants to come up and play, feel free. We’ve always given that kind of privilege to any great guitar player, like Brian May. He’s in the same place as Brian May or Slash.”
Johnny Depp is no stranger to the world of rock n roll, being a member of a number of bands in his earlier years before he hit the big time as an actor. He has also contributed to a number of tracks since, including ‘Fade In-Out‘ from Oasis’ 1997 album ‘Be Here Now‘.
